1.  FM RECEIVNG ANTENNA 

(Fig.1-1)

 

The  electric  wave  of  FM  broadcasting  is  weakening  in 

valleys, around buildings and in iron-reinforced buildings 
because if its own nature.

 

• Installation of an antenna exclusively for FM

 

    Connect the 75ohm coaxial cable of the antenna to the 

terminal of 75ohm. Listening to the broadcasting, fix it 

after deciding the location and the direction so that the 
receipt condition may be optimum.

 

• Installation of an antenna using the coaxial cable

 

    You  may  have  noise  at  the  crowded  downtown,  city 

streets and factory sites as well as around power ca-

bles, even in the case of using an antenna exclusively 
for FM. In these regions, install it through connection 
with a coaxial cable of 75ohm.

 

• FM Indoor antenna

 

    In the regions where FM broadcasting is heard compa

-

ratively well due to good signal strength. You can re-

ceive broadcasting of good quality b y using T-type an

-

tenna at the best place for reception after connecting it 

with a terminal of 75ohm. 

2.  AM RECEIVING ANTENNA 

(Fig.1-2)

 

• AM lead antenna

 

    Connect 6 ~ 8M cable to the AM terminal and route ca

-

ble to give the best reception. Keep away from power 
cables and fluorescent lights.

 

• AM outdoor antenna

 

    Install the vinyl-coated cable outdoors if indoor recep

-

tion is poor.

 

• Earthing cable (GND)

 

    Broadcasting may be heard well without earth connec-

tion. But connect the earthing cable to earth for safety 
and reduction of noise.
